How they compare
Kuwait currently reports 32.13 billion current US$ against 26.34 billion current US$ in Syria, a difference of 5.79 billion current US$.
That makes Kuwait's figure about 1.2 times Syria's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 11 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Kuwait ahead.
Kuwait ranks 39th and Syria ranks 42nd of 176 countries.
Kuwait has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
Net national savings are equal to gross national savings less the value of consumption of fixed capital.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
